    18-day Campaign to End Violence Against Women: SLSU Addresses Women Rights

    • Posted by slsu21
    • Categories News, OP
    • Date November 29, 2021

    The Southern Luzon State University Gender and Development (GAD) Office, in participation on the 18-day campaign to end violence against women (VAW), conducts a two-day webinar tackling the issues surrounding VAW.

    During the first webinar on November 29, GAD Head Dr. Susana Salvacion, and VP for AFA Dr. Frederick Villa encouraged the participants to contribute to a less violent world. Dr. Villa assured that every man in SLSU is one in acknowledging and respecting the rights and privileges of women.

    VP for REPDI Dr. Marissa Esperal commended the events that GAD facilitated. Meanwhile, Dr. Doracie Zoleta-Nantes shared her thoughts about violence – stating that families with enough resources have a hard time in dealing with abuse, what more are those who have barely enough.

    The guest speaker, Atty. Eric Pail Peralta talked about the legal mandates on VAW. He expounded the laws surrounding violence. Catch the full discussion here: https://fb.watch/9Ag5IOE56H/.

    What is SLSU?

    Southern Luzon State University (SLSU) is the premier higher education institution in Quezon Province in the Philippines. Its main campus is in Lucban.

    OUR COMMITMENT

    The SLSU is committed to prepare its students for a rapidly changing world by providing a quality education. It shall also increase the knowledge base through research, convert new intellectual property into economic development, provides expertise and innovative solutions to business, governments, and others who seek assistance.
